本文主要是介绍【Python】Python_learning1:python的def函数用法,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
一、函数调用的含义
- 函数是类似于可封装的程序片段。允许你给一块语句一个名字,允许您在你的程序的任何地方使用指定的名字运行任何次数。
- python中有许多内置函数,如len和range。
- 函数概念可能是任何有价值软件中最重要的块(在任何编程语言中)。
二、定义函数使用def关键字
- 在这个关键字之后是标识函数的名字;
- 其次是在一对括号中可以附上一些变量名;
- 最后在行的末尾是冒号。
- 接下来是语句块--函数的一部分。
函数定义举例:
#coding =utf-8 ''' File:Created on 2016-08-18 Author: Sure ''' _author_ = 'Sure' def SayHello():print ("hello world!");print ("he!");print ("llo wld!");print ("!");SayHello() #调用函数第一次 SayHello() #调用函数第二次
hello world!
he!
llo wld!
!
hello world!
he!
llo wld!
!
---------------------------------------------------------------------------------------------------------------------------
它是如何工作的:
- 使用上述语法,定义一名为SayHello的函数。这个函数没有参数,因此无需在圆括号中声明变量。
- 当函数中包含参数时,说明语句块中将会用到该参数;
- 函数的参数代入到函数下方的语句块,以便给它传递不同的值返回相应的结果。
这篇关于【Python】Python_learning1:python的def函数用法的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!